在云计算时代,云服务器已成为企业数据存储和处理的中心,为了确保数据的安全和高效传输,使用Putty进行数据传输成为了一种常见的选择,以下将详细介绍如何使用Putty向云服务器传输数据,包括准备工作、连接步骤和传输方法。

准备工作
安装Putty
确保您的计算机上已安装Putty,Putty是一款开源的SSH客户端,可以在其官方网站(https://www.putty.org/)免费下载。
获取云服务器信息
获取云服务器的IP地址、用户名和密码,这些信息通常在云服务提供商的控制台中找到。
配置SSH密钥(可选)
为了提高安全性,您可以选择使用SSH密钥对进行认证,而不是传统的用户名和密码,这需要生成一对密钥,并将公钥上传到云服务器。
连接步骤
启动Putty
打开Putty,在“Host Name (or IP address)”栏中输入云服务器的IP地址。

选择连接类型
在“Connection”选项卡中,选择“SSH”作为连接类型。
设置认证信息
在“Session”选项卡中,输入用户名,如果使用SSH密钥认证,需要选择“Auth”选项卡,并选择相应的私钥文件。
连接服务器
点击“Open”按钮,Putty将尝试连接到云服务器,如果一切正常,您将看到命令行界面。
传输方法
使用SCP
SCP(Secure Copy)是一种用于在本地计算机和远程服务器之间安全传输文件的协议。

- 本地到服务器:在命令行中输入
scp 本地文件路径 用户名@服务器IP:服务器文件路径。 - 服务器到本地:在命令行中输入
scp 用户名@服务器IP:服务器文件路径 本地文件路径。
使用SFTP
SFTP(SSH File Transfer Protocol)是一种基于SSH的安全文件传输协议。
- 启动SFTP客户端:大多数操作系统都内置了SFTP客户端,或者您可以使用第三方软件,如FileZilla。
- 连接到服务器:在SFTP客户端中输入云服务器的IP地址、用户名和密码。
- 传输文件:在SFTP客户端中,您可以通过拖放或使用命令行来传输文件。
表格对比
| 传输方法 | 安全性 | 速度 | 易用性 |
|---|---|---|---|
| SCP | 高 | 中 | 较高 |
| SFTP | 高 | 高 | 较高 |
FAQs
Q1:使用Putty传输数据时,如何确保数据的安全性?
A1: 使用SSH协议进行加密传输,确保数据在传输过程中的安全性,使用SSH密钥对进行认证比使用密码更安全。
Q2:Putty是否支持文件压缩传输?
A2: 不支持,Putty本身不提供文件压缩功能,如果您需要压缩文件,可以在传输前使用第三方工具(如WinRAR)进行压缩,然后再使用SCP或SFTP进行传输。
图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/169243.html
